Job Description:

The Warehouse Lead helps coordinate the shipping, warehousing, and related support activities to assure compliance with applicable safety regulations, quality standards, and on-time completion of shipping product schedules. Works closely with other departments, such as Production, Quality Assurance, R&D, Warehouse, and Maintenance, as needed. This position ensures adherence to policies and procedures, and recommends improvements in equipment, operating procedures, and working conditions. In support of cost-control efforts, this role identifies and helps resolve operations issues.
